    Why Aluminum Fishing Boats?

    Before we get into the specifics of Bass Pro's offerings, let's talk about why aluminum boats are so popular in the first place. Aluminum boats have carved a niche for themselves in the world of fishing, and for good reason. These boats offer a compelling blend of durability, lightweight design, and affordability, making them an attractive option for anglers of all levels. One of the most significant advantages of aluminum boats is their resistance to corrosion. Unlike their fiberglass counterparts, aluminum boats don't suffer from gel coat blisters or osmotic degradation. This makes them particularly well-suited for saltwater environments, where the corrosive effects of salt can quickly deteriorate other materials. The lightweight nature of aluminum also contributes to improved fuel efficiency, allowing you to spend more time on the water and less time at the gas pump. Furthermore, aluminum boats are incredibly durable and can withstand impacts and abrasions that might cause significant damage to fiberglass hulls. This ruggedness makes them ideal for navigating shallow, rocky waters or for those who tend to be a bit rough on their equipment. Another compelling factor is the lower maintenance requirements of aluminum boats. They don't require waxing or polishing like fiberglass boats, and repairs are often simpler and more affordable. This can save you a significant amount of time and money in the long run, allowing you to focus on what truly matters: fishing. In terms of performance, aluminum boats offer excellent stability and maneuverability, making them a joy to handle on the water. They are also relatively easy to trailer and launch, which is a significant advantage for anglers who frequently travel to different fishing spots. Finally, aluminum boats are an environmentally friendly option. Aluminum is a recyclable material, and the manufacturing process is generally less polluting than that of fiberglass. This makes them a sustainable choice for anglers who are conscious of their environmental impact. All things considered, aluminum fishing boats offer a compelling package of advantages that make them a popular choice among anglers. Their durability, lightweight design, affordability, and low maintenance requirements make them an ideal option for a wide range of fishing activities.

    Pros and Cons of Bass Pro Aluminum Fishing Boats

    Okay, let's get down to the nitty-gritty. What are the actual advantages and disadvantages of choosing a Bass Pro aluminum fishing boat? No boat is perfect, so it's important to weigh the pros and cons before making a decision. It’s essential to consider both the upsides and downsides to ensure you're making an informed decision that aligns with your fishing needs and preferences. Let’s break down the pros first:

    • Affordability: This is a big one. Bass Pro aluminum boats are generally more budget-friendly than fiberglass options, making them accessible to a wider range of anglers. The lower price point allows more people to enjoy the sport of fishing without breaking the bank.
    • Durability: Aluminum is a tough material that can withstand bumps, scrapes, and the general wear and tear of fishing. This ruggedness makes them ideal for navigating shallow, rocky waters or for those who tend to be a bit rough on their equipment.
    • Lightweight: Aluminum boats are easier to tow and launch than heavier fiberglass boats. The lightweight design also contributes to improved fuel efficiency, saving you money on gas.
    • Low Maintenance: Aluminum doesn't require the same level of maintenance as fiberglass, saving you time and money on upkeep. The minimal maintenance requirements allow you to spend more time fishing and less time worrying about boat care.
    • Versatility: Bass Pro offers a variety of models suitable for different types of fishing and water conditions. The wide range of options ensures that you can find a boat that meets your specific needs and preferences.

    Now, let's delve into the cons:

    • Ride Quality: Aluminum boats can be a bit bumpier in rough water compared to the smoother ride of fiberglass boats. The lighter weight can cause them to be more susceptible to the effects of waves and chop.
    • Noise: Aluminum can be noisier than fiberglass, which can be a concern for stealthy fishing. The metal hull can amplify sounds, potentially spooking fish.
    • Looks: Let's be honest, aluminum boats don't always have the sleek, stylish look of fiberglass boats. While aesthetics are subjective, some anglers prefer the appearance of fiberglass boats.
    • Resale Value: Aluminum boats may not hold their value as well as fiberglass boats over time. The depreciation rate can be higher for aluminum boats, which is something to consider if you plan to sell your boat in the future.
    • Welding: The quality of the welds is crucial in an aluminum boat. Poor welds can lead to leaks and structural problems. It's essential to inspect the welds carefully before purchasing a boat to ensure they are strong and well-executed.

    Choosing the Right Bass Pro Aluminum Fishing Boat

    So, you're leaning towards a Bass Pro aluminum boat? Great! Here's how to make sure you pick the right one for your needs. Selecting the ideal fishing boat involves a thoughtful assessment of your individual requirements and preferences. It's not just about picking the flashiest model; it's about finding a boat that will serve you well for years to come. First, consider the type of fishing you'll be doing most often. Are you a bass fisherman who needs a boat with a casting deck and livewell? Or are you more into crappie fishing and prefer a smaller, more maneuverable boat? The type of fishing you do will significantly impact the features and layout you need in a boat. Next, think about the size of the water you'll be fishing in. If you're primarily fishing on small lakes and ponds, a smaller boat will suffice. But if you plan to venture out onto larger bodies of water, you'll need a boat that can handle the chop and waves. Consider the boat's capacity and weight rating to ensure it can safely accommodate you and your passengers, as well as your gear. It's also important to think about storage. Fishing gear can take up a lot of space, so you'll want a boat with ample storage compartments for rods, tackle, and other essentials. Look for features like rod lockers, tackle trays, and storage boxes to keep your gear organized and easily accessible. Don't forget to consider the features that will enhance your fishing experience. Things like livewells, fish finders, and trolling motors can make a big difference in your success on the water. Think about the features that are most important to you and prioritize them when choosing a boat. Of course, budget is always a consideration. Bass Pro offers a range of aluminum boats at different price points, so you'll need to find one that fits your budget. Remember to factor in the cost of accessories like a trailer, motor, and electronics. Before making a final decision, take the boat for a test drive. This will give you a feel for how it handles on the water and whether it meets your expectations. Pay attention to things like stability, maneuverability, and ride quality. Finally, read reviews and talk to other anglers who own Bass Pro aluminum boats. Their experiences can provide valuable insights and help you make an informed decision. By carefully considering these factors, you can choose the right Bass Pro aluminum fishing boat for your needs and enjoy years of fishing fun.

    Alternatives to Bass Pro Aluminum Fishing Boats

    Bass Pro isn't the only player in the aluminum fishing boat game. There are other brands out there that offer comparable boats, each with its own strengths and weaknesses. Exploring these alternatives can help you make a more informed decision and find the perfect boat for your needs. When considering alternatives to Bass Pro aluminum fishing boats, it's essential to look at brands like Tracker, Lowe, Crestliner, and Alumacraft. Each of these manufacturers offers a range of aluminum fishing boats designed for various fishing styles and water conditions. Tracker Boats, for example, is known for its value-packed packages that include a boat, motor, and trailer. They offer a variety of models, from jon boats to deep-V fishing boats, catering to a wide range of anglers. Lowe Boats is another popular choice, offering a diverse lineup of aluminum fishing boats known for their durability and performance. They have models suitable for everything from small lakes to large rivers, with features like livewells, rod storage, and comfortable seating. Crestliner Boats is a premium brand that focuses on quality and innovation. Their aluminum fishing boats are known for their superior construction, advanced features, and smooth ride. They offer a range of models, from bass boats to multi-species fishing boats, designed to meet the needs of serious anglers. Alumacraft Boats is a well-established brand with a long history of building reliable and durable aluminum fishing boats. They offer a variety of models, from jon boats to deep-V fishing boats, with a focus on functionality and affordability. When comparing these alternatives, consider factors like price, features, construction quality, and warranty. Each brand has its own strengths and weaknesses, so it's essential to do your research and find the boat that best meets your specific needs and preferences.
